Nick Jones Posted January 4, 2009 Share Posted January 4, 2009 Hm. I wouldn't mind a 525D Touring, but I'm missing 46000 Euro. So I'm as likely to drive a beemer again as I am to get the above figure as a monthly salary You're missing the point (on purpose probably). You let someone else spend the €46,000 , then wait patiently while all their money evaporates away, then buy it for € 4,600 about 5 years later. Or, if you're feeling really patient, € 460 10 years later. Of course there are already lots of matured ones out there..... Nick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Nick Jones Posted January 7, 2009 Share Posted January 7, 2009 Local garage owner used to have a c plate 525e. He had it for years and years, loved it. It was high (260ish k) mileage when he got it in the early 90s and it finally died in 2006 (of terminal rust mind, not mechanicals) at just shy of 500k! It did get it's oil changed though. I was there one day when he was trying to work out how many tyres it had had....... Nick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
